MARIA'S PORTUGUESE BACALAU

This is a traditional Portuguese dish that brings back memories of mom. It is not only tasty but it is always a hit at parties. Plan ahead, because the salted cod needs to soak for 24 hours.

Provided by BINGADING

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     Portuguese

Time P1DT2h

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 12



Maria's Portuguese Bacalau image

Steps:

  • Soak the dried salted cod in cold water for 24 hours, changing the water several times.
  •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Add the soaked cod, and boil for about 5 minutes, or until fish flakes easily with a fork. Remove cod from water, and save water for cooking potatoes. Remove skin and bones from the cod, and flake the meat into pieces using a fork. Set fish aside in a large bowl.
  • In a small bowl, stir together the olive oil, 1 clove of garlic, 1 tablespoon of parsley, red pepper flakes, and black pepper. Pour over the fish, and toss lightly to coat.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Place the potatoes into the fish water, and bring to a boil. Cook for 20 minutes, or until tender. Drain under cool water, peel and cut into 1/4 inch slices.
  • While the potatoes are cooking, melt the but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the onions, and saute until golden and caramelized. Stir one clove of garlic into the onions. Set aside.
  • Layer half of the potato slices in the bottom of a greased 8x11 inch baking dish. Cover with half of the cod, then half of the onions. Repeat layers, ending with onion.
  • Bake for 15 minutes in the preheated oven, until lightly browned. Before serving, garnish the top with green and black olives, and hard-cooked eggs. Sprinkle with remaining parsley.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 701 calories, Carbohydrate 25.2 g, Cholesterol 277 mg, Fat 31.3 g, Fiber 2.5 g, Protein 77.1 g, SaturatedFat 7 g, Sodium 8223.1 mg, Sugar 1.5 g

2 pounds dried salted cod fish
4 Yukon Gold potatoes
3 tablespoons butter
2 yellow onions, thinly sliced
2 cloves garlic, chopped, divided
½ cup chopped fresh parsley, divided
¾ cup olive oil
1 ½ teaspoons red pepper flakes
freshly ground pepper to taste
4 hard cooked eggs, chopped
10 pitted green olives
10 pitted black olives

PORTUGUESE BACALHAU à BRáS (SALT COD AND POTATOES)

This is a very unique Portuguese Salt Cod fish dish. Very popular in the Azores Islands of Portugal. Cooked for many occasions and well enjoyed. To save yourself time you can prepare the potatoes ahead of time and let them soak in water untill you are ready to start your dish. Also please note, the Cod must be soaked in water overnight. However if you miss this step you can boil the Cod in a pot of water and keep changing the water a few times. This is to remove the salt from the Cod. Use Boneless Salted Cod (not frozen). You can find this in many Super Markets. I have mentioned below that you can also use a Food Processor and shred the potatoes and onion for ease. You can also cheat by using a family size bag of shoestring french fries ;) Prep time does not include soaking of the Cod.

Provided by daisygrl64

Categories     High Protein

Time 1h15m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15



Portuguese Bacalhau à Brás (Salt Cod and Potatoes) image

Steps:

  • Note: Soak Cod fish in water overnight.
  • Next day change water and place Cod in a pot with enough water to cover it. Boil for about 15 minutes. Drain and let cool. Once Cod has cooled, flake it.
  • Add 1 tbsp of olive oil to non stick pan and fry potatoes in batches each time using another tbsp of olive oil if necessary.
  • Place paper towel on the bottom of a glass dish safe for the oven and keep fries warm in the oven.
  • Once you are done with the potatoes add 1 tbsp of olive oil to pan and add the bay leaf. Simmer for about 2-3 minutes. remove bay leafs from pan (discard).
  • add garlic, onions (pepper flakes if using) to the pan and saute until onions begin to soften.
  • add the parsley and let saute a bit.
  • add flaked Cod and keep tossing until Cod gets warm.
  • add the eggs, keep stirring so not to let the eggs stick to pan. this mixture will start to look like scrambled eggs.
  • Once you are done with your Cod and eggs mixture.
  • Combine fries with Cod mixture.
  • add olives if using.
  • taste, add salt and black pepper if needed.
  • when serving squeeze lemon juice from a slice of lemon ontop.
  • add dash of tabsco sauce if using.
  • Enjoy.

1 1/2-2 lbs dried salt cod fish
8 russet potatoes, peeled, cut into matchstick pieces (I am basing the serving by 2 potatoes per person)
olive oil, divided
3 medium size onions, cut in half, then sliced thinly (like half moon slices)
4 bay leaves
6 -8 eggs, beaten
1/4 cup chopped parsley
2 tablespoons minced garlic
1 teaspoon hot pepper flakes (optional)
3 dashes Tabasco sauce (optional)
green olives, or
black olives
salt and black pepper (according to taste)
lemon wedge
you can use a food processor to shred the potatoes and onions. you can also cheat by using a family French fries

BACALHAU COM NATAS | TRADITIONAL SALTWATER FISH DISH FROM ...
Bacalhau com natas is one of the most famous Portuguese dishes made with salted cod. The dish is a combination of soaked or boiled cod topped with diced fried potatoes, generously doused with cream and baked until golden brown in color. Since it is extremely popular, it appears in numerous versions.

BACALHAU: A GUIDE TO PORTUGAL’S FAVOURITE FISH – PORTUGALIST
The bacalhau should sit in the bowl with the skin facing up. Make sure the bacalhau is completely covered in water: a good ration to follow is 2/3 water to 1/3 bacalhau. Change the water at least 2-3 times per day. Ideally, the last water change should take place around 2 hours before cooking it.
